为什么选择Go语言?_语言运行速度快_如何选择合适的Go开发工具

为什么选择Go语言?

选择Go语言,主要是因为它有几个特别吸引人的特点:

- 语法简洁:Go语言的语法设计得非常简单,只有25个关键字,容易上手。 - 并发强大:Go语言内置了goroutine和channel,能轻松处理大量并发任务,非常适合像Web服务器和微服务这样的应用。 - 性能优越:Go语言运行速度快,垃圾回收机制高效,适合构建高性能的应用程序。 - 跨平台支持:Go语言可以在多种操作系统和硬件平台上运行,方便跨平台开发和部署。

Go语言的并发性能强

Go语言的并发性能主要得益于以下三个方面:

语法简洁易学

Go语言的简洁语法包括以下特点:

生态系统完善

Go语言的生态系统非常强大,包括:

强大的标准库

Go语言的标准库非常强大,包括:

跨平台支持

Go语言的跨平台支持包括:

Go语言因其并发性能强、语法简洁易学、生态系统完善、强大的标准库和跨平台支持,是处理高并发和跨平台应用的一个优秀选择。开发者应该深入了解其并发机制和标准库,以充分发挥Go语言的性能和效率。

相关问答FAQs

问题 答案
为什么选择Go语言? Go语言语法简洁、并发能力强、性能优越、跨平台支持好。
如何选择合适的Go框架? 考虑框架的功能、稳定性、文档和性能。
如何选择合适的Go开发工具? 选择适合自己的IDE、调试工具、版本控制和包管理工具。